HP LaserJet 5Si and 5Si/5Si MS PS Prints Euro Symbol Incorrectly (193935)
The information in this article applies to:
- Microsoft Windows 98
- Microsoft Windows 95

When you print a document that contains the euro symbol to a Hewlett-
Packard (HP) LaserJet 5Si or 5Si/5Si MX PS printer, the euro symbol may be
printed as a black dot or blank space.
CAUSE
This behavior can occur if TrueType fonts are not sent to the printer as
bitmap soft fonts.
RESOLUTION
To resolve this behavior, follow these steps:
- Click Start, point to Settings, and then click Printers.
- Right-click your HP LaserJet 5Si or 5Si/5Si MX PS printer, and then
click Properties.
- Click the Fonts tab.
- For HP LaserJet 5Si/5Si MX PS printers, click Always Use TrueType
Fonts, click Send Fonts As, click Bitmaps under TrueType Fonts, click
OK, and then click OK again.
For HP LaserJet 5Si printers, click "Download TrueType fonts as bitmap
soft fonts," and then click OK.
